Tailoring Your Digital Marketing Strategy for Roofing Companies

Amidst the endless possibilities of digital marketing, roofing companies often find themselves attempting to prioritize their efforts in a complex and rapidly changing world. What works one week could easily become ineffective the next, causing even the best-laid plans to fall short of expectations. Crafting a comprehensive marketing strategy that resonates with your target audience and promotes maximum reach is essential for securing ongoing results - but where do you start? The secret lies in understanding your core objectives, leveraging data-driven insights, and tailoring all elements of your approach toward maximizing ROI on each dollar spent. By following these guidelines, roofing companies can effectively recalibrate their digital advertising focus and break through any challenges standing in their way.

Defining Your Target Audience for Roofing Companies

When it comes to marketing for roofing companies, it’s important to define your target audience. This allows you to tailor your messaging and methods to better resonate with potential customers. Your target audience might include homeowners in a specific geographic area or those with certain demographics or needs. For example, if you specialize in eco-friendly roofing solutions, your target audience might be environmentally-conscious homeowners looking to reduce their carbon footprint. By defining your target audience, you can focus your marketing efforts on reaching the right people and building a more effective strategy for growing your business.

Leveraging Social Media for Roofing Advertising

In today’s digital world, social media has become a powerful tool for businesses of all trades, and roofing advertising is no exception. By leveraging social media platforms such as Facebook, Twitter, and Instagram, roofing companies can expand their reach and connect with potential customers in a cost-effective manner. Social media enables businesses to showcase their work, share educational content, and provide valuable roofing tips to their followers. It also offers a platform for customers to leave recommendations, further enhancing the business’s reputation. With so many options available, it is important for roofing companies to develop a comprehensive social media strategy that aligns with their business goals and target audience. Utilizing social media for roofing advertising can effectively contribute to growing a business’s customer base and increasing revenue.

Building a Comprehensive Digital Presence with SEO

In today’s digital age, having a strong online presence is crucial for businesses of all sizes. Search engine optimization, or SEO, plays a vital role in building a comprehensive digital presence. By optimizing your website and content for search engines, you can increase your visibility online and attract more potential customers. This involves using targeted keywords and phrases, creating engaging and high-quality content, and building quality links to your website. With the right SEO strategy, you can not only improve your search engine ranking but also establish your brand as a thought leader in your industry. So if you haven’t already, it’s time to focus on building a comprehensive digital presence with SEO.

Increasing Brand Awareness with PPC Advertising

PPC advertising has become an essential tool for businesses looking to increase their brand awareness online. With the vast number of people spending significant amounts of time on the internet each day, it has never been more critical to get your message in front of the right audience. PPC advertising provides an effective way to do this, using search engines and social media platforms to target users already interested in your product or service. Whether you’re a small start-up or a well-established company, PPC advertising can help you reach your marketing goals and achieve greater success in today’s competitive digital landscape. You can use external tools to automate your campaigns, for instance using an Amazon PPC tool for your online store.

Analysing Results and Adapting Your Strategy

When it comes to analyzing the results of your strategy, there are several factors to consider. First, it’s important to determine what metrics you will use to measure success. These metrics could include website traffic, conversion rates, or revenue growth. Once you have established these metrics, you can begin to track your progress over time. This will allow you to spot trends and identify areas where your strategy may need adjustment. It’s important to remain flexible and open to change, as your strategy should evolve alongside your business. By regularly analyzing your results and adapting your strategy accordingly, you can ensure that your business stays on track toward achieving its goals.

Maximizing ROI with Retargeting Strategies

Retargeting can be a highly effective way to maximize your return on investment (ROI) from digital advertising. By specifically targeting consumers who have previously shown an interest in your product or service, retargeting allows you to personalize your messaging and increase the likelihood of conversion. Various retargeting strategies are available, including website retargeting, email retargeting, and social media retargeting. Each has its own unique benefits and can be tailored to fit the needs of your business. By implementing these retargeting strategies, you can stay top of mind with potential customers and drive them towards making a purchase while also getting the most out of your advertising budget.


There are a variety of strategies that you can use for roofing marketing. The most important aspect to consider first is your target audience and what type of content resonates with them the most. Utilizing a social media strategy, building a comprehensive digital presence with SEO, increasing brand awareness through PPC advertising, analyzing results, adapting your strategy accordingly, and maximizing ROI with retargeting strategies will ensure that your roofing business stands out from the competition. By following these steps and creating an effective advertising plan, you can start to attract more potential customers and take your roofing company to the next level. It's time to let potential customers find out about your exceptional service and start bringing in more business today.